Stuffed bread: here’s a great way to surprise your guests!

Quick and easy to make, delicious and impossible not to try at least once! INGREDIENTS
Bread
brie
Fontina
Maasdam
Rosemary
Honey
Zucchini
Bacon
METHOD
All you will need is a loaf of bread that is not too tough, and any filling you like! Make three holes in the loaf of bread. Stuff one with brie, herbs and honey. Fill the next hole with fontina cheese and fried zucchini. Fill the last hole with Maasdam and smoked bacon. Use the pieces of bread, that were previously removed from the loaf, to make croutons. Pour some oil on top, add some rosemary and bake for 20 minutes. Serve hot!
